Sandra, the nanny who rescued two-year-old Moshe Holtzberg from the Islamic terrorists that stormed the Chabad House in Mumbai, is expected to arrive in Israel on Monday and be granted entry by the Interior Ministry.
The toddler whose parents Rabbi Gavriel and Rivka Holtzberg were murdered in the Beit Chabad massacre along with other Israelis was reunited with his Israeli grandparents, Shimon and Yehudit Rosenberg, on Friday.
The Holtzbergs arrived in Mumbai in 2003 to run a synagogue and Torah classes as part of Chabad Movement,their door was constantly open to the hundreds of Israelis visiting the region, offering them
a place to eat and a place to sleep.
The identities of other Israelis murdered in the Chabad House aside from the Holtzbergs are
kashrut supervisors Rabbi Leibish Teitelbaum, a US citizen who lived in Jerusalem;
Bentzion Chroman, an American-Israeli from Bat-Yam; and Yochevet Orpaz, of Givatayim,
who had arrived in India to visit her daughter and two grandchildren. 11/30/08
